There are one thing I disagree, and one I agree:

  1. agreed with the frustrating “silver sink” system. Actually, IMC made the game in a way that NPCs are extremely irrelevant from the mid-game onwards. If you would highlight someone that is actually used, would be the Blacksmith. I’d love to see other NPCs selling useful stuff and services, and letting the game to have some other types of silver sinks that players could make use of, without just wasting money. If players could buy powerful SP potions, for example, only from NPCs and those actually were up to their cooldown and weight, it would be very nice to have in end-game characters, even if they would cost shitloads of silver. What I’m trying to say is that IMC could redesign some NPCs to become silver sinks with some better usage for the players.

  2. I totally disagree with the game being fated to “death” if nobody returns after combat system rework. There are already those who play, and that will be the game community for a long, long time. The only thing IMC could actually do is to introduce more end-game content, or contents that players can use without getting bored. Well, actually it’s all about farming, doing instances and going team battles. I don’t see a lot of people going for the guild battles, which were launched as one of the IMC’s biggest promises and revolutions. I’d really love to see more of that “region domination” thing in practice. Another idea is to bring something based on the Garrison system from WoW, that you have to grind a lot for items, quests and stuff to upgrade it and unlock some cool and useful stuff.

Don’t believe that ToS is doomed. However, it truly need some work to not die. I hope that IMC is really looking after new ideas for keeping end-game players busy.
